Transaction 899b1686245e2594aa6152f53aaca3a38816d2ae1217482721ce1f7413714832
1 Input
1 Output
-
899b1686245e2594aa6152f53aaca3a38816d2ae1217482721ce1f7413714832:0
- value
- 6622200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b070a428d8613d5a8856e046a406e52c080bc8ff OP_EQUAL
- address
- 3Hmwnkrwp1oVSkn4kG27cN67DVF5difaHA